Boca Juniors' Rodrigo Palacio Looking Foward To Genoa Future
The Argentine is excited at the prospect of playing in Italy as he waits to undergo a medical with the Grifoni...
After recently arriving in Italy to undergo a medical ahead of his proposed move from Boca Juniors to Genoa, Rodrigo Palacio has spoken of his excitement at the opportunity to play for the Grifoni.
“I am very happy at the possibility of coming to play here in Genova,” he declared to Datasport.
“This is a great opportunity for me and it is arriving just at the right moment in my career. Genoa is a very ambitious club, with a squad that is hoping to stay at the top of their game to emulate last season’s success.”
Given the historic links between Genova and Buenos Aires, Palacio looked to add a touch of fate to his imminent switch to the Grifoni.
“I am here to bring the warmest regards from your Boca cousins, where the families of many Genovese immigrants still reside today," he stated.
